How Data Sharding Boosts Blockchain Speed
The cryptocurrency industry is experiencing rapid growth, with blockchain technology at its core. As more users engage with decentralized applications (dApps) and transactions increase, the need for speed and efficiency in blockchain networks has never been more critical. One innovative solution that has emerged to address these challenges is data sharding. This article delves into how data sharding enhances blockchain speed, its benefits, and real-world applications.
Understanding Data Sharding
Data sharding is a database architecture pattern that involves breaking up large datasets into smaller, more manageable pieces called shards. Each shard is stored on a separate database server, allowing for parallel processing and improved performance. In the context of blockchain, sharding enables the network to process multiple transactions simultaneously, significantly increasing throughput.
The Need for Speed in Blockchain
As the cryptocurrency market expands, the demand for faster transaction processing times has surged. Traditional blockchains like Bitcoin and Ethereum face scalability issues, leading to slower transaction speeds and higher fees during peak times. For instance, Ethereum’s average transaction time can exceed 15 seconds, while Bitcoin can take up to 10 minutes. These delays can hinder user experience and limit the adoption of blockchain technology.
How Data Sharding Works
Data sharding divides the blockchain into smaller segments, allowing different nodes to handle different shards. This division means that each node only needs to process a fraction of the total transactions, leading to:
- Increased Throughput: More transactions can be processed simultaneously.
- Reduced Latency: Faster confirmation times for transactions.
- Scalability: The network can grow without significant performance degradation.
In a sharded blockchain, each shard operates independently, maintaining its own state and transaction history. This independence allows for greater flexibility and efficiency, as nodes can focus on their specific shard without being bogged down by the entire network’s workload.
Benefits of Data Sharding in Blockchain
Implementing data sharding in blockchain networks offers several advantages:

- Enhanced Performance: Sharding allows for parallel processing, which can dramatically increase the number of transactions per second (TPS). For example, Ethereum 2.0 aims to achieve up to 100,000 TPS through sharding.
- Cost Efficiency: With faster processing times, transaction fees can decrease, making blockchain more accessible to users.
- Improved User Experience: Quicker transaction confirmations lead to a smoother experience for users interacting with dApps.
- Decentralization: Sharding can help maintain decentralization by allowing more nodes to participate in the network without overwhelming them.
Real-World Applications of Data Sharding
Several blockchain projects are already implementing data sharding to enhance their performance:
Ethereum 2.0
Ethereum 2.0 is one of the most anticipated upgrades in the blockchain space. It aims to transition from a proof-of-work (PoW) to a proof-of-stake (PoS) consensus mechanism. A key feature of Ethereum 2.0 is its sharding implementation, which is expected to significantly increase the network’s scalability and speed. By dividing the blockchain into 64 shards, Ethereum 2.0 can process multiple transactions simultaneously, addressing the current limitations of the Ethereum network.
Zilliqa
Zilliqa is another blockchain that utilizes sharding to enhance its performance. It employs a unique consensus mechanism called Practical Byzantine Fault Tolerance (PBFT) combined with sharding to achieve high throughput. Zilliqa can process thousands of transactions per second, making it one of the fastest blockchains available. This speed has attracted various dApps and projects to build on its platform.
Near Protocol
Near Protocol is designed for high-performance decentralized applications. It uses a dynamic sharding mechanism that allows the network to adjust the number of shards based on demand. This flexibility ensures that the network can handle varying loads efficiently, providing a seamless experience for users and developers alike.
Challenges of Data Sharding
While data sharding offers numerous benefits, it also presents challenges that need to be addressed:
- Complexity: Implementing sharding requires significant changes to the blockchain architecture, which can be complex and time-consuming.
- Security Concerns: Sharding can introduce new security vulnerabilities, as attackers may target specific shards to compromise the network.
- Data Consistency: Ensuring data consistency across shards can be challenging, especially during high transaction volumes.
Future of Data Sharding in Blockchain
The future of data sharding in blockchain technology looks promising. As more projects adopt sharding techniques, we can expect to see:
- Increased Adoption: More blockchain networks will implement sharding to improve scalability and performance.
- Innovative Solutions: Developers will continue to create new methods for sharding, addressing current challenges and enhancing security.
- Interoperability: Sharded blockchains may develop ways to communicate with each other, creating a more interconnected blockchain ecosystem.
FAQs about Data Sharding in Blockchain
What is data sharding?
Data sharding is a method of breaking up large datasets into smaller, manageable pieces called shards, allowing for parallel processing and improved performance in blockchain networks.
How does data sharding improve blockchain speed?
By allowing multiple transactions to be processed simultaneously across different shards, data sharding increases throughput and reduces latency, leading to faster transaction confirmations.
What are some examples of blockchains using data sharding?
Ethereum 2.0, Zilliqa, and Near Protocol are notable examples of blockchains that implement data sharding to enhance their performance and scalability.
What challenges does data sharding face?
Challenges include complexity in implementation, potential security vulnerabilities, and ensuring data consistency across shards.
Conclusion
Data sharding represents a significant advancement in blockchain technology, addressing the critical need for speed and scalability in the cryptocurrency industry. By breaking down large datasets into smaller shards, blockchain networks can process transactions more efficiently, enhancing user experience and fostering greater adoption of decentralized applications.
As projects like Ethereum 2.0, Zilliqa, and Near Protocol demonstrate the potential of sharding, the future of blockchain technology looks brighter than ever. For those interested in staying updated on cryptocurrency news and price tracking, platforms like Bitrabo provide valuable resources.
For more insights and updates, follow me on X, Instagram, Facebook, and Threads.
Disclaimer: The information provided in this article is for informational purposes only and should not be considered financial advice. Always conduct your own research before making investment decisions.
The Crypto Watchlist of the Week 🔎
Subscribe to receive expert-curated projects with real potential—plus trends, risks, and insights that matter. Get handpicked crypto projects, deep analysis & market updates delivered to you.


